Property Report
This property is a 4-bedroom house, located at 49, Park Hill Drive, LE2 8HS, Leicester, built between 1930-1949. It features 100 square meters of floor area, a semi-detached build type, and fully double-glazed windows. The energy rating is 'D', indicating a moderate level of energy efficiency. The property has mains gas for heating and hot water, with a boiler and radiators, and a programmer and room thermostat for control. It also has 5 heated rooms and 1 extension. The energy costs are £867 per year. The property's current energy consumption is 275 units per year, with a potential reduction of 147 units per year.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 747 out of 999.
